Web Design Emphasizes Web Design: Principles and Practices

User-Centered Web Design is a design philosophy that places the needs and desires of users at the forefront of the design process. It's a collaborative approach that aims to create websites that are intuitive, accessible, and delightful for all users. This paradigm involves understanding user needs, conducting user research, creating prototypes, and testing designs with real users to obtain feedback and iteratively refine the design.

Key principles of User-Centered Web Design include:

  • Emphasizing user research to understand user goals, habits, and pain points.
  • Designing interfaces that are clear, concise, and easy to navigate.
  • Offering helpful and informative content that is relevant to the user's needs.
  • Making sure accessibility for all users, regardless of their limitations.
  • Regularly testing and refining designs based on user feedback.

Contemporary Website Trends to Enhance Your Online Presence

In today's dynamic digital landscape, it's essential for businesses to maintain a modern online presence. To captivate your target audience and shine, it's imperative to implement the latest website trends.

One notable trend is the rise of minimalist designs, which prioritize user experience and clarity. Websites with a concise layout promote easy navigation and optimize content consumption.

Another prominent trend is the growing popularity of interactive elements, such as animations, microinteractions, and interactive features. These elements capture user attention and create a more lasting online experience.

  • Moreover, websites are increasingly leveraging artificial intelligence (AI) to tailor the user journey. AI-powered chatbots and personalized content delivery can deliver relevant information and improve customer engagement.
  • Moreover, the trend of mobile-first design continues to gain traction. Websites that are optimized for mobile devices provide a seamless and enjoyable experience for users across all platforms.
